[docs]class OdbRigidBody: """The Rigid body object is used to bind a set of elements and/or a set of nodes and/or an analytical surface with a reference node. Notes ----- This object can be accessed by: .. code-block:: python import odbAccess session.odbs[name].parts[name].rigidBodies[i] session.odbs[name].rootAssembly.instances[name].rigidBodies[i] session.odbs[name].rootAssembly.rigidBodies[i] session.odbs[name].steps[name].frames[i].fieldOutputs[name].values[i].instance.rigidBodies[i] """ def __init__(self, referenceNode: OdbSet, position: SymbolicConstant = INPUT, isothermal: Boolean = ON, elements: OdbSet = OdbSet('set', tuple[OdbMeshNode]()), tieNodes: OdbSet = OdbSet('set', tuple[OdbMeshNode]()), pinNodes: OdbSet = OdbSet('set', tuple[OdbMeshNode]()), analyticSurface: AnalyticSurface = AnalyticSurface()): """This method creates a OdbRigidBody object. Notes ----- This function can be accessed by: .. code-block:: python session.odbs[*name*].rootAssembly.instances[*name*].RigidBody session.odbs[*name*].rootAssembly.RigidBody Parameters ---------- referenceNode An OdbSet object specifying the reference node set associated with the rigid body. position A SymbolicConstant specifying the specific location of the OdbRigidBody reference node relative to the rest of the rigid body. Possible values are INPUT and CENTER_OF_MASS. The default value is INPUT. isothermal A Boolean specifying specify whether the OdbRigidBody can have temperature gradients or be isothermal. This is used only for fully coupled thermal-stress analysis The default value is ON. elements An OdbSet object specifying the element set whose motion is governed by the motion of rigid body reference node. tieNodes An OdbSet object specifying the node set which have both translational and rotational degrees of freedom associated with the rigid body. pinNodes An OdbSet object specifying the node set which have only translational degrees of freedom associated with the rigid body. analyticSurface An AnalyticSurface object specifying the analytic surface whose motion is governed by the motion of rigid body reference node. Returns ------- An OdbRigidBody object. """ pass
